Use Local SEO and Google My Business

Since most dental practices rely primarily on local business, optimizing your content for local SEO is critical for raising your online presence. When you are offering a local service in a certain region, you need to target local keywords and include things like your city. Terms like “dentists near me” and “dentist in (your city)” will help you stand out in location-specific searches. Creating blogs and other articles with your targeted keywords as part of your content marketing strategy will also be very helpful for your local search engine rankings.

Having an optimized Google My Business listing is also very important for local search results. Updating your info in your GMB profile ensures that your Google Maps location, your dental practice’s address, and details like your business hours show up in local searches. Basically, your GMB listing is a verified source of information about your dental practice. It also gives patients a simple way to review your practice, which can help your Google rating.

Capitalize on Social Media Marketing

There are over 3.5 billion active social media users and nearly half of them use these platforms to research products prior to purchasing. Clearly, social media is fertile ground for sharing your dental practice’s important selling points and bolstering its reputation.

Maintaining social media pages helps your practice connect with both current and potential patients. Not only can you include positive patient reviews, but you can also address any problems or concerns patients may have about your practice. Facebook’s messenger feature, which lets you answer questions directly, is very helpful in these cases.

The great thing about social media marketing is that it strengthens your online profile and your website’s SEO ranking. All the likes, shares, views, and referrals on social media pages generate more organic traffic. In addition, many social channels also let you promote your business through paid advertising. For these reasons, dental practices that stay active on social media wind up with better leads, more website traffic, and new patients.

Take Advantage of Video Marketing

Many experts agree that video marketing is one of the most exciting dental marketing trends with plenty of room left to grow. In fact, internet users spend a third of their time online watching video, which amounts to nearly 7 hours of video per week. Video can help you share important information about different treatments, procedures, and even a behind-the-scenes tour of your dental operation.

Adding videos to your YouTube channel, for instance, can help your brand and your dental SEO. Indeed, video content practically guarantees higher conversion rates; it increases social media shares and reinforces a more personal connection with your dental practice. In other words, it’s a great tool for highlighting your expertise and the people involved in your practice.

Keep Your Blog Content Fresh

How is your dental blog looking these days? Unfortunately, dated and irrelevant content is an all-too-common problem among dental practice websites. You never want to miss out on a chance to establish your brand’s authority and create value for your patients. Relevant, authoritative content also helps your search engine rankings. By discussing common dental problems, tips, and the latest techniques, you can connect with both existing and prospective patients. Because people are always looking for information, an up-to-date blog is another way to answer questions and position yourself as an expert.
